Christopher Abbott, renowned for his compelling roles in both film and television, recently shared his intense experience while filming Wolf Man. The actor described the process as both terrifying and transformative, pushing him far beyond his usual acting comfort zone.

In Wolf Man, Abbott tackles the daunting task of transforming into a fearsome monster. He is joined by Julia Garner and newcomer Matilda Frith, both of whom contribute their talents to the film.

To fully immerse himself in the role, Abbott had to endure hours of meticulous makeup application to achieve the monster’s look. He humorously noted, “There’s a lot of sugar in that blood stuff,” referring to the fake blood used in the film. He also recalled one particular scene where he gnaws on his own leg, admitting, “It’s scary, but also ridiculous.”

Abbott explained that the role required unusual research, saying, “For the first time, I had to look into more National Geographic-type material than for other films.” As the process of becoming the character unfolded, he noted the shifting balance of his portrayal, which began as “80 percent human, 20 percent animal” before transforming further.

Despite the fear that came with the role, Abbott found the entire experience rewarding. He described it as a “real eye-opener,” one that left a lasting impression on him.
